Today I woke up and was very excited to start our trip. After eating breakfast, we all hopped in the van and took off. Thankfully we packed the night before. We were on our way to Cincinnati. Our hotel is the Omni Netherland Plaza , which is in the historic Carew Tower in the downtown area. We will drive for about 95 miles southwest from Dublin to get there. I thought it would take a little longer than two hours to get parked and into the hotel, but we made it in a little shorter time.

After checking into our hotel, we realized how cool it was to stay in such an old building. The Omni Netherland Plaza is almost 90 years old. Our rooms are really nice and there is a door in between them. Here is a picture our room.

We decided we were going to visit the Cincinnati Fire Museum . It was really fun. I learned a lot about the history of fire trucks and fire fighting equipment. I decided that it would have been hard to be a fire fighter 100 years ago. Hank thought the old fire trucks were very interesting. After leaving the museum we walked along the Ohio River for a little bit. It was bigger than I thought, but you could still see Kentucky, which I thought was very neat. The bridge that spanned the Ohio River was really cool. Ellie liked seeing seagulls in Ohio, I thought that was pretty neat as well.
